    <td><font face="verdana" size="1">Luallen had a solid junior campaign in which he threw for 916 yards and 13 touchdowns, while not giving up a single interception.


    Luallen is a tremendous athlete and can beat the defense with both his arm and his legs. He is very mobile in the pocket and has decent footwork. He has good vision downfield and throws well on the run. Has a fairly good arm. Will sometimes throw off his back foot, resulting in a weak pass here and there.</font></td>
